Pick the Best Tool for Content Marketing Automation
Choosing the right content marketing automation tools can really influence your business. But where do you begin? Start by identifying the key factors that matter to you most.
Looking at Automation Options is crucial. Basic automation uses rules to complete tasks based on certain conditions. On the other hand, AI-driven solutions use predictive analytics for smarter decisions. These AI tools learn from past interactions and provide smart suggestions, improving campaign effectiveness.
Next, consider budget and ROI expectations. Studies show an average return of $5.44 for every dollar spent on marketing automation. When checking out tools, keep these pricing tiers in mind:
Small Businesses: $50 to $150 monthly.
Mid-sized Businesses: $150 to $500 monthly.
Large Enterprises: $500 to $2,000+ monthly.
Knowing these costs helps match your budget with your expected returns.
Another important factor is integration capabilities with your current marketing setup. Make sure the tool can easily work with your CRM and other important platforms. A smooth data flow is key for getting the most out of your tool by ensuring systems work well together.

Main Features Setting Advanced Automation Tools Apart
In content marketing automation, tools can differ quite a bit. Some features can significantly shape your marketing results. So, what features should you focus on?
AI-guided content creation and improvement are leading the trend. With 90% of content marketers planning to use AI by 2025, AI is essential, not optional. Additionally, 77% use AI tools for personalized content, making it possible to create messages that resonate more deeply with audiences.
Automated distribution and scheduling across multiple channels is vital. Handling posts on different platforms can be a hassle. Good tools make this easier, helping maintain a consistent brand image everywhere.
Detailed analytics and performance insights set the best options apart. Top platforms provide real-time optimization and forward-looking insights. This enables you to understand what works and tweak strategies immediately, skipping long waits for monthly reports.

Failures in Content Marketing Automation and How to Overcome Them
Many companies jump into content marketing automation with big hopes but often end up disappointed. So, what's going wrong? Pinpointing the main reasons for failure is crucial to creating a better plan.
A major stumbling block is making content that drives action, with 40% of marketers seeing this as a major issue. This often connects to limited resources (39%) and a lack of expertise (55.6%). Without a solid strategy, efforts can become scattered, resulting in mixed messages that don’t engage.
There's also the heavy reliance on automation without enough human input. Many believe automation will achieve results by itself. This dependence can lead to missed chances that need human insight, like adjusting in real-time based on audience response.
Moreover, content quality issues often stem from inconsistencies in brand voice. AI can struggle to keep a brand's identity steady, sometimes producing incorrect info. This inconsistency can push your audience away, undermining the trust you've built.

Content Marketing Automation: A Practical Guide
Starting with content marketing automation is simple. Break it down into steps for an easy transition and lasting results.
Step 1: Evaluate and Plan
First, take a look at your current content processes. Identify repetitive tasks in creation, distribution, and analytics. This helps spot where automation works best.
Then, establish clear goals and metrics for automation. Important ones to track are:
Time savings
Content consistency
Engagement rates
Lead generation
Conversion rates
Finally, make sure your data is ready for integration. Check data quality and accessibility to aid personalization.
Step 2: Select and Launch
Begin with key low-risk automation tasks. Automate things like social media posts or email series first. Set up content approval systems and keep human checks for AI-generated content.

Looking at Automation Success Beyond Basic Metrics
To really understand how content marketing automation is working, you need to think beyond just clicks and views. It's important to see how automation ties into your business goals. One significant area is checking efficiency improvements and how resources are used. Doing this helps teams save up to 30% of their time, letting them focus on important projects instead of everyday tasks.
Another key point is to ensure consistent content quality across all platforms. It's vital to track if the content matches your brand's voice and message. Inconsistent messaging can hurt brand identity and lose audience trust, so staying true to your brand voice is essential.
Additionally, look at how audience engagement improves and how well personalized content works. A notable 74% of marketers using AI for segmentation saw better conversion rates, showing the power of personalization in building audience connections.
Assessing long-term ROI is important too. Think about indirect benefits like better team productivity, increased scalability, and staying competitive. These factors provide a fuller picture of success.
